首页 » 智能 » 101C语言,计算机编程的基石与未来

101C语言,计算机编程的基石与未来

duote123 2025-01-06 14:52:11 0

扫一扫用手机浏览

文章目录 [+]

自计算机诞生以来,编程语言作为人与计算机沟通的桥梁,见证了计算机技术的发展历程。在众多编程语言中,C语言以其简洁、高效、易学等特点,成为计算机编程领域的基石。本文将从C语言的历史、特点、应用以及未来发展趋势等方面进行探讨。

一、C语言的历史与发展

101C语言,计算机编程的基石与未来 智能

1. C语言的历史

C语言由美国贝尔实验室的Dennis Ritchie于1972年发明,最初是为了编写操作系统UNIX。自那时起,C语言迅速在计算机编程领域崭露头角,成为了事实上的标准语言。随着计算机技术的发展,C语言不断演变,衍生出许多方言,如C++、C等。

2. C语言的发展趋势

如今,C语言已成为计算机编程领域的基石,广泛应用于操作系统、嵌入式系统、游戏开发等领域。随着人工智能、大数据等新兴领域的兴起,C语言在未来的发展将更加多元化。

二、C语言的特点

1. 简洁、易学

C语言语法简洁,易于上手。其基本语法与自然语言相近,便于初学者理解。C语言强调变量声明、类型检查等编程规范,有助于培养良好的编程习惯。

2. 高效、稳定

C语言编写的程序执行速度快,占用系统资源少,具有很高的稳定性。这使得C语言成为操作系统、嵌入式系统等对性能要求较高的领域的首选语言。

3. 可移植性强

C语言具有高度的抽象性,编写的程序可在不同平台上运行,具有很强的可移植性。这使得C语言在跨平台开发中具有很高的优势。

三、C语言的应用

1. 操作系统

C语言在操作系统领域的应用尤为突出,如Linux、Windows等主流操作系统均采用C语言编写。

2. 嵌入式系统

C语言在嵌入式系统领域具有广泛的应用,如智能家居、工业控制系统等。

3. 游戏开发

C语言在游戏开发领域具有很高的地位,许多知名游戏引擎如Unreal Engine、Unity等均采用C语言编写。

四、C语言的未来发展趋势

1. 跨平台开发

随着跨平台技术的发展,C语言将更加注重跨平台开发,提高编程效率。

2. 人工智能与大数据

C语言在人工智能、大数据等领域具有很高的应用价值,未来将进一步加强在这些领域的应用。

3. 教育与普及

C语言作为计算机编程的基石,将继续在教育领域发挥重要作用,培养更多优秀的计算机人才。

C语言作为计算机编程领域的基石,具有悠久的历史、丰富的特点和应用。在未来的发展中,C语言将继续发挥重要作用,推动计算机技术的进步。作为一名计算机编程者,掌握C语言将有助于我们更好地应对未来的挑战。

标签:

相关文章

PWM电机系统漏电流分析_电流_电机

针对此问题,首先对PWM电机系统正常泄电流打算模型和流利路径进行研究,然后对系统的泄电故障点及相应故障泄电流进行了剖析,末了通过试...

智能 2025-01-14 阅读0 评论0